What is an ADHD Assessment?
An ADHD assessment is a structured procedure that assists health care experts detect ADHD by evaluating a person's behavior, signs, and effect on everyday performance. The assessment usually consists of a mix of interviews, surveys, and standardized tests.
Key Components of an ADHD Assessment
Medical Interviews: Conducted with the individual and, if appropriate, their parents or guardians. This allows for an extensive understanding of the individual's signs and history.

Standardized Questionnaires: These are utilized to quantify symptoms and compare them against established criteria.

Observation: Professionals may observe the person in various settings, such as in the house or in school, to examine how symptoms manifest in real-life situations.

Collaboration with Other Professionals: In some cases, the assessment may consist of feedback from teachers, pediatricians, or psychologists who have communicated with the individual in different environments.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. The length of time does an ADHD assessment take?
The duration of an ADHD assessment can differ however normally lasts between 1 to 2 hours. Conclusion of questionnaires prior to the visit can extend this time, overall assessment time may span numerous weeks when considering follow-ups and feedback.
2. Do I need a recommendation for an ADHD assessment?
For the most part, a referral from a GP is required for accessing professional assessments in the NHS. Nevertheless, [Private Health Insurance ADHD Assessment](https://blackwomeneverywhere.com/author-profile/private-adhd7054/) assessments might not need a referral.
3. Exists an age limitation for ADHD assessment?
ADHD can be detected at any age. Nevertheless, assessments often concentrate on kids, however adults looking for diagnosis or treatment can also undergo assessment.
4. What is the cost of an ADHD assessment?
Expenses can vary considerably based upon whether the assessment is through the NHS or privately. NHS assessments are typically complimentary at the point of usage, while private assessments can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 1,000 or more.
5. What if I don't concur with the assessment results?
People and households deserve to seek a consultation if they are not pleased with the assessment results. Engage with the health care supplier for clarification and explore choices for a reassessment.
